Subject[PATCH] Revert "tools lib lk: Fix for cross build"
Date
This reverts commit 079787f209416416383c74ea5d5044be2d586f5e.

Below commit already resolve a cross build problem.
I have been noticed this too lately.

commit 3c4797d46c14fa0c7cf733a77bd4b28875078b53
Author: Rabin Vincent <rabin@rab.in>
Date: Fri May 17 22:27:44 2013 +0200

tools lib lk: Respect CROSS_COMPILE

Make lk use CROSS_COMPILE, in order to be able to cross compile perf
again.

Signed-off-by: Joonsoo Kim <iamjoonsoo.kim@lge.com>

diff --git a/tools/lib/lk/Makefile b/tools/lib/lk/Makefile
index 280dd82..3dba0a4 100644
--- a/tools/lib/lk/Makefile
+++ b/tools/lib/lk/Makefile
@@ -3,21 +3,6 @@ include ../../scripts/Makefile.include
CC = $(CROSS_COMPILE)gcc
AR = $(CROSS_COMPILE)ar

-# Makefiles suck: This macro sets a default value of $(2) for the
-# variable named by $(1), unless the variable has been set by
-# environment or command line. This is necessary for CC and AR
-# because make sets default values, so the simpler ?= approach
-# won't work as expected.
-define allow-override
- $(if $(or $(findstring environment,$(origin $(1))),\
- $(findstring command line,$(origin $(1)))),,\
- $(eval $(1) = $(2)))
-endef
-
-# Allow setting CC and AR, or setting CROSS_COMPILE as a prefix.
-$(call allow-override,CC,$(CROSS_COMPILE)gcc)
-$(call allow-override,AR,$(CROSS_COMPILE)ar)
-
# guard against environment variables
LIB_H=
LIB_OBJS=
